I am not sure I understand the question… Does the customer want to do reporting? Performing an SQL statement and getting back data is what a Quick Report does, or one can create an IAL or Lobby data source to return data.
If you mean an Oracle facility to take any string and execute it, I would wonder why that is desirable? SQL can already perform very advanced queries where you can return almost anything you can imagine, including hierarchical, pivoted, and list-aggregated data. Throw in some WITH statements, sub-selects, and API calls and there isn’t much you can’t do.
In PL/SQL code, you can write code that returns datasets via things like dynamic querying, ref cursors, and pipelining. Is that what they are referring to?
